Are Press-On Nails Safer Than Acrylics? A Comprehensive Guide
For many beauty enthusiasts, choosing between press-on nails and acrylics is a common dilemma. Safety is often a top concern when selecting a nail enhancement method. Based on recent insights and industry data, press-on nails are generally considered safer than acrylics due to their non-invasive application and lack of harsh chemicals. 1. What Are the Safety Differences Between Press-On Nails and Acrylics?
Press-on nails are often deemed safer than acrylics because they do not require harsh chemicals like acetone for removal or strong adhesives during application. According to dermatological insights from sources like the Cleveland Clinic (April 2024), press-on nails pose fewer risks of nail bed damage and allergic reactions compared to acrylics, which involve monomers and often require extensive buffing of the natural nail. Acrylics can also lead to long-term thinning of the nail plate if not applied or removed correctly, whereas press-ons are temporary and easily removable with minimal impact.
2. Do Press-On Nails Cause Less Damage to Natural Nails?
Yes, press-on nails are less damaging to natural nails compared to acrylics or gel manicures. As noted by LOA Nails (2022), the primary damage from acrylics and gels comes from acetone soaks and aggressive buffing, which can weaken the nail bed. Press-on nails, applied with adhesive tabs or glue, do not require such invasive processes, making them a gentler option for maintaining nail health during frequent use.
3. Are Press-On Nails Easier to Apply and Remove Than Acrylics?
Press-on nails are significantly easier and quicker to apply and remove than acrylics. According to Allure (2020), press-ons can be applied at home in minutes without professional assistance, using simple adhesive tabs or glue. Removal is straightforward—often involving warm water or gentle peeling—while acrylics require professional soaking in acetone for 10-20 minutes, which can be time-consuming and damaging if done improperly.
4. How Do the Costs of Press-On Nails Compare to Acrylics?
Press-on nails are generally more cost-effective than acrylics. A set of high-quality press-on nails can range from $8 to $30, as highlighted by Byrdie (2025), and can be reused multiple times if maintained properly. In contrast, acrylic manicures at a salon can cost between $30 to $60 per session, with additional costs for removal and maintenance, making press-ons a budget-friendly alternative for regular users.
5. What Are the Potential Risks of Using Press-On Nails?
While press-on nails are safer overall, they are not without risks. The Cleveland Clinic (2024) warns that improper application or prolonged wear can lead to moisture trapping, increasing the risk of fungal infections. Allergic reactions to adhesive glue are also possible, though less common than reactions to acrylic chemicals. To minimize risks, users should follow application instructions, avoid wearing press-ons for more than 7-10 days at a time, and ensure proper nail hygiene.

How long do Crystal Point Sticks and Wooden Sticks last?
Crystal Point Stick: With proper care, a crystal stick can last for many years. The tip will likely remain sharp and effective unless it’s dropped or damaged.
Wooden Stick: Wooden sticks typically last for a good amount of time but can wear down more quickly due to splintering, especially if used frequently.
